29 extern "C" int
ndb_back_bind(Operation * op,SlapReply * rs)30 ndb_back_bind( Operation *op, SlapReply *rs )
31 {
32 struct ndb_info *ni = (struct ndb_info *) op->o_bd->be_private;
33 Entry e = {0};
34 Attribute *a;
35
36 AttributeDescription *password = slap_schema.si_ad_userPassword;
37
38 NdbArgs NA;
39
40 Debug( LDAP_DEBUG_ARGS,
41 "==> " LDAP_XSTRING(ndb_back_bind) ": dn: %s\n",
42 op->o_req_dn.bv_val, 0, 0);
43
44 /* allow noauth binds */
45 switch ( be_rootdn_bind( op, NULL ) ) {
46 case LDAP_SUCCESS:
47 /* frontend will send result */
48 return rs->sr_err = LDAP_SUCCESS;
49
50 default:
51 /* give the database a chance */
52 break;
53 }
54
55 /* Get our NDB handle */
56 rs->sr_err = ndb_thread_handle( op, &NA.ndb );
57
58 e.e_name = op->o_req_dn;
59 e.e_nname = op->o_req_ndn;
60 NA.e = &e;
61
62 dn2entry_retry:
63 NA.txn = NA.ndb->startTransaction();
64 rs->sr_text = NULL;
65 if( !NA.txn ) {
66 Debug( LDAP_DEBUG_TRACE,
67 LDAP_XSTRING(ndb_back_bind) ": startTransaction failed: %s (%d)\n",
68 NA.ndb->getNdbError().message, NA.ndb->getNdbError().code, 0 );
69 rs->sr_err = LDAP_OTHER;
70 rs->sr_text = "internal error";
71 goto done;
72 }
73
74 /* get entry */
75 {
76 NdbRdns rdns;
77 rdns.nr_num = 0;
78 NA.rdns = &rdns;
79 NA.ocs = NULL;
80 rs->sr_err = ndb_entry_get_info( op, &NA, 0, NULL );
81 }
82 switch(rs->sr_err) {
83 case 0:
84 break;
85 case LDAP_NO_SUCH_OBJECT:
86 rs->sr_err = LDAP_INVALID_CREDENTIALS;
87 goto done;
88 case LDAP_BUSY:
89 rs->sr_text = "ldap_server_busy";
90 goto done;
91 #if 0
92 case DB_LOCK_DEADLOCK:
93 case DB_LOCK_NOTGRANTED:
94 goto dn2entry_retry;
95 #endif
96 default:
97 rs->sr_err = LDAP_OTHER;
98 rs->sr_text = "internal error";
99 goto done;
100 }
101
102 rs->sr_err = ndb_entry_get_data( op, &NA, 0 );
103 ber_bvarray_free_x( NA.ocs, op->o_tmpmemctx );
104 ber_dupbv( &op->oq_bind.rb_edn, &e.e_name );
105
106 /* check for deleted */
107 if ( is_entry_subentry( &e ) ) {
108 /* entry is an subentry, don't allow bind */
109 Debug( LDAP_DEBUG_TRACE, "entry is subentry\n", 0,
110 0, 0 );
111 rs->sr_err = LDAP_INVALID_CREDENTIALS;
112 goto done;
113 }
114
115 if ( is_entry_alias( &e ) ) {
116 /* entry is an alias, don't allow bind */
117 Debug( LDAP_DEBUG_TRACE, "entry is alias\n", 0, 0, 0 );
118 rs->sr_err = LDAP_INVALID_CREDENTIALS;
119 goto done;
120 }
121
122 if ( is_entry_referral( &e ) ) {
123 Debug( LDAP_DEBUG_TRACE, "entry is referral\n", 0,
124 0, 0 );
125 rs->sr_err = LDAP_INVALID_CREDENTIALS;
126 goto done;
127 }
128
129 switch ( op->oq_bind.rb_method ) {
130 case LDAP_AUTH_SIMPLE:
131 a = attr_find( e.e_attrs, password );
132 if ( a == NULL ) {
133 rs->sr_err = LDAP_INVALID_CREDENTIALS;
134 goto done;
135 }
136
137 if ( slap_passwd_check( op, &e, a, &op->oq_bind.rb_cred,
138 &rs->sr_text ) != 0 )
139 {
140 /* failure; stop front end from sending result */
141 rs->sr_err = LDAP_INVALID_CREDENTIALS;
142 goto done;
143 }
144
145 rs->sr_err = 0;
146 break;
147
148 default:
149 assert( 0 ); /* should not be reachable */
150 rs->sr_err = LDAP_STRONG_AUTH_NOT_SUPPORTED;
151 rs->sr_text = "authentication method not supported";
152 }
153
154 done:
155 NA.txn->close();
156 if ( e.e_attrs ) {
157 attrs_free( e.e_attrs );
158 e.e_attrs = NULL;
159 }
160 if ( rs->sr_err ) {
161 send_ldap_result( op, rs );
162 }
163 /* front end will send result on success (rs->sr_err==0) */
164 return rs->sr_err;
165 }
